Spoiler: What you need
Image
You'll need a piece of paper/cardboard or whatever you wish to make it out of. :yogi:
Scissors
Glue
Paper
Ruler

Spoiler: Step 1
Image
First cut out the calling card (we're going to glue the stuff on later) my measurements (and the template's measurements)
for the card were:
10cm Width
5.8cm Height

Configure these measurements if you want. :keiko:


Spoiler: Step 2
Image
Paste the Template for the front on the card (Make sure the template touches the top, it's ok that it doesn't fit, we'll fix that later)


Spoiler: Step 3
Image
Cut off the part of the card that stick out, so you have a clean front.
It'll then look like this:
Image


Spoiler: Step 4
Image
Paste the back Template on the other part of the card. Yes, the back is bigger then the front. This will be fixed later


Spoiler: Step 5
Image
Fold the card, now do what you did back in Step 3, i used yellow cardboard, so i cut off the yellow cardboard that sticks out.
It should end up like this:
Image


Finish'd! :keiko:
